본문 바로가기
반응형

전체 글19

파이썬 데이터 직렬화를 위한 라이브러리 목록 데이터 직렬화란, 어떤 자료구조를 저장하거나 전송할 수 있는 기계가 인식할 수 있는 형태로 변환하는 것을 의미합니다. Python에서는 여러가지 데이터 직렬화 라이브러리가 존재합니다. 일부를 소개해드리겠습니다. 1. pickle: Python 자체적으로 제공하는 데이터 직렬화 라이브러리입니다. 기본적인 자료구조(리스트, 튜플, 딕셔너리 등)을 직렬화할 수 있습니다. 이 라이브러리를 사용하면, Python 코드에서 생성한 객체를 직렬화해서 파일에 저장하거나, 직렬화된 객체를 읽어와서 Python 코드에서 사용할 수 있습니다. 2. json: Python과 자바스크립트 언어 사이에서 데이터를 주고받을 때 사용하는 인기있는 데이터 직렬화 포맷입니다. 일반적인 자료구조(리스트, 튜플, 딕셔너리, 스트링 등)을 .. 2022. 12. 29.
파이썬 웹 개발 라이브러리 목록 Python에는 웹 개발을 위한 많은 라이브러리가 있습니다. 일부 대표적인 라이브러리를 소개하겠습니다. 1. Django: 오픈 소스 웹 프레임워크로, 간편한 웹 애플리케이션 개발을 지원합니다. 2. Flask: 작은 웹 애플리케이션을 위한 오픈 소스 웹 프레임워크로, 유연하고 쉽게 확장할 수 있습니다. 3. Pyramid: 웹 애플리케이션 개발을 위한 오픈 소스 프레임워크로, 작은 애플리케이션부터 큰 애플리케이션까지 다양한 용도로 사용할 수 있습니다. 4. Bottle: 작은 웹 애플리케이션을 위한 오픈 소스 프레임워크로, 코드가 간결하고 쉽게 유지보수할 수 있습니다. 5. Tornado: 실시간 웹 애플리케이션을 위한 오픈 소스 웹 서버 프레임워크로, 적은 자원으로도 고성능을 제공합니다. 6. Web.. 2022. 12. 29.
파이썬 라이브러리 목록 파이썬에는 다양한 기능을 제공하는 라이브러리가 많이 있습니다. 일부 라이브러리를 한글로 소개하면 다음과 같습니다. 1. NumPy: 수치 계산을 위한 라이브러리로, 큰 크기의 다차원 배열과 행렬을 지원하며, 이들 배열에 적용할 수 있는 많은 수학 함수를 제공합니다. 2. SciPy: 과학 계산을 위한 라이브러리로, 배열 처리, 수치 최적화, 신호와 영상 처리 등을 제공합니다. 3. Pandas: 데이터 조작과 분석을 위한 라이브러리로, CSV, Excel, SQL 데이터베이스 등 다양한 형식의 데이터 읽기와 쓰기를 지원합니다. 4. Matplotlib: 파이썬에서 정적, 애니메이션, 상호 작용 시각화를 생성하기 위한 라이브러리입니다. 5. Seaborn: Matplotlib 기반의 통계 데이터 시각화 라.. 2022. 12. 29.
파이썬 입문 가이드 파이썬은 웹 개발, 과학 연산, 데이터 분석, 인공 지능 등 다양한 용도에 사용되는 인기 프로그래밍 언어입니다. 프로그래밍을 처음 접하시고 파이썬을 배우고 싶다면 아래의 자료들이 도움이 될 수 있습니다. 파이썬 문서(https://docs.python.org/3/)는 파이썬 언어와 표준 라이브러리를 입문할 때 좋은 자료가 될 수 있습니다. 인터넷에서 수많은 튜토리얼과 인터랙티브 코스가 제공되고 있어서 파이썬을 쉽게 배울 수 있습니다. 인기 자료로는 Codecademy(https://www.codecademy.com/learn/learn-python)과 Coursera(https://www.coursera.org/courses?query=python)가 있습니다. 구조적인 강의를 선호하시는 경우, 파이썬 .. 2022. 12. 29.
반응형